HPCalc
Health Physics Calculations with Confidence
Version, environment, capabilities, and scope boundaries.
Version: 1.0.0-alpha.3
Environment: Production (development or production only; no secrets or raw env vars are shown here.)
Validation status: 3 bundled datasets checked, 3 fully valid, 0 with validation messages. Release builds are also checked with lint, unit tests, production build, and Playwright accessibility smoke/contrast suites (see CHANGELOG.md).
Current capabilities
- External dose screening calculators (decay, point source, time–distance, narrow-beam shielding) and a radiation unit converter (optional converter report).
- Nuclide catalog reference view with confidence labels and half-life display.
- Contamination screening worksheets and internal dose screening tools.
- Gamma spectroscopy screening and training calculators (energy/efficiency/ROI/FWHM/MDA-style estimates).
- Air sampling and DAC integration screening (sample volume, concentration, DAC fraction and DAC-hours, filter count, grab-sample documentation).
- Waste planning and decay-in-storage documentation tools (decay estimator, ten half-lives, inventory worksheet, survey checklist—no disposal authorization).
- Training Academy modules and quiz progress tracking (browser-local).
- Zod-validated report payloads with copy summary, JSON, Markdown, and print-friendly views.
Current limitations
- No certified internal dosimetry, medical evaluation, or regulatory dose assignment.
- No formal structural shielding design engine (buildup, scatter, broad-beam, workload/occupancy, skyshine, and similar).
- No peak fitting, spectrum file parsing, automated nuclide ID, or certified spectroscopy lab replacement.
- No regulatory waste disposal or release determinations, decay-in-storage clearance, or replacement for licensee waste management programs.
- No replacement for approved procedures, lab QA programs, or licensed vendor workflows.
Data confidence and reports
Bundled and user-entered values use confidence labels (validated, reference-derived, illustrative, user-supplied, placeholder). See Data confidence help for how these affect trust.
Reports capture inputs, assumptions, warnings, references, and disclaimers. Exports can be blocked until required documentation or schema checks pass. See the reports and exports help page for details.
Safety and scope disclaimer
HPCalc is for radiation protection training, screening calculations, and documentation support. It does not replace qualified professional judgment, approved procedures, certified lab methods, or regulatory decision processes.
Accessibility
HPCalc targets Section 508 / WCAG AA accessibility practices, but should not be represented as fully 508 compliant until a formal accessibility audit is completed.
Accessibility help and the accessibility baseline document describe current goals and limitations.